If your teenager is finding school hard right now, support is available.

Our Tailored Learning program (formerly FLO) supports students in Years 8 – 12 who are disengaged from school or facing barriers that make regular attendance difficult. It’s flexible, personalised, and built around each young person’s wellbeing, strengths and goals.

We often hear the same questions from parents: Will my child stay enrolled? Do they need a diagnosis? What does support actually look like?

Swipe along below to get answers to these questions and more.

Tailored Learning works alongside schools and families, offering one-on-one mentoring, flexible learning options, wellbeing support and clear pathways beyond school, with support that continues during school holidays.

Today, 13 February, marks the 18th anniversary of the National Apology.

On this day in 2008, the Australian Government formally apologised to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ples, particularly the Stolen Generations, for the laws and policies that caused profound grief, suffering and loss through forced child removal and assimilation.

The Apology followed the Bringing Them Home report, which documented the lived experiences of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people. Through powerful testimony and submission, the inquiry revealed lifelong consequences: families separated for decades, parents who never stopped searching for their children, and communities carrying deep and ongoing trauma. It also recognised that many others were unable to share their experiences due to trauma, distance or fear.

While the Apology could not erase the harm of the past, it marked an important step toward acknowledgement, healing, and national truth-telling.

Today, Sonder remembers the Stolen Generations, honours their strength and resilience, and reaffirms our commitment to listening, learning, and walking together toward justice and reconciliation.

Sonder has been selected by SA Health to deliver a new Crisis Stabilisation Centre at the Lyell McEwin Hospital Precinct in Adelaide’s north.

This new 16-bed service will be open 24/7, 365 days a year, providing a safe, supportive and home-like environment for people experiencing mental health distress – as an alternative to going to an Emergency Department.

This is a big step forward for mental health care in Adelaide’s north, and we’re honoured to be delivering this important service in close partnership with SA Health and the Northern Adelaide Local Health Network - NALHN.

The centre has been co-designed with people who have lived experience, and will be staffed by a caring team of peer practitioners, mental health clinicians, Aboriginal Social and Emotional Wellbeing Workers, multicultural workers, and medical staff.

It will be co-located with the Northern Adelaide Medicare Mental Health Centre, helping people move seamlessly between crisis support and ongoing care.

📍 Relocation update: As part of this project, the Northern Adelaide Medicare Mental Health Centre will relocate from Gillingham Road, Elizabeth, to the new facility on Oldham Road.
